Pin-Hao Huang

Pin-Hao Huang is a Research Engineer at Honda Research Institute USA, Inc. since June 2023. Previously, Pin-Hao Huang worked as a Perception Research Engineer Intern at TuSimple from May 2022 to August 2022, where a data generation pipeline for stereo 3D object detection was designed. Prior experience includes serving as a Research Assistant at the Institute of Information Science, Academia Sinica from July 2018 to July 2021, focusing on knowledge distillation methods to enhance the accuracy of small CNN models. Pin-Hao Huang holds a Master of Engineering in Robotics from the University of Maryland, earned in May 2023, and a Bachelor of Science in Bio-Industrial Mechatronics Engineering from National Taiwan University, completed in 2018.
